Variety characteristics
Height : 40 cm (16")
Flower size : Medium
Exposure : Full sun to partial shade
Hardiness : Not hardy (zones 8-10, must be dug up before winter)
Deer resistance : Yes
Water requirements : Medium (moist but well-drained soil)
Ideal soil : Loamy or clayey, acidic to neutral pH
Quantity : 1 rhizome
Planting and cultivation of Calla 'Mercedes'
When to plant?
From March to May , after the last frosts.
Where should I plant it?
In open ground : Ideal for flowerbeds and bright borders .
In a pot : Sublime for terraces and balconies .
How to plant?
1?? Plant the rhizome 10 cm deep , pointed end upwards.
2?? Space the plants 30 cm apart for a nice distribution.
3?? Water lightly after planting , then maintain regular moisture.
4?? Add a liquid fertilizer every 2 weeks for prolonged flowering.

Calla 'Mercedes' Maintenance
Watering : Keep the soil moist but well drained .
Fertilizer : Apply a balanced fertilizer every 15 days during the flowering period.
Size : Remove faded flowers to prolong blooming.
Wintering :
Dig up the rhizomes after the first frosts , let them dry and store them in a cool, dry place.
